Internal Validation of Rapid and Performance Method for Patulin Determination in Apple Cider by High-Performance Liquid Chromatography

An analytical method was developed and validated for separation, detection and quantification of patulin in apple cider by high performan celiquid chromatography (HPLC-DAD). Extraction and clean-up of patulin from apple cider are achieved on AFFINIMIP (R) SPE PATULIN cartridge (3mL/100mg). Patulin was separated on a C18 Hypersil GOLD column (150 mm x 4 mm, 5 mu m) coupled to a Hypersil Gold guard column (10 x 4.0 mm, 5 mu m) using mobile phase consisting of water:acetonitrile (95:5, v/v) and detected at 276 nm. The method has a good sensitivity (LOD = 2.63 mu g/mL and LOQ = 8.45 mu g/mL) and a good precision (RDS (r) = 0.32...0.91% for injection repeatability; RSD (r) = 1.05....2.98% for analysis repeatability intra-day; RSD (R) = 1.35....3.24% for intermediate precision; RSD (R) = 1.64....3.86% for intra-laboratory reproducibility). The method was applied by analyzing samples of apple cider purchased from commerce. In case of 80% of the analyzed samples, patulin was not detected, and for the rest of them concentration of patulin was < LOQ.
